i have one sheet that the i (4th column) when i select the cell i can send a update request.

This is leu of selecting the row, right click my mouse, select send. After i send the email, it puts a envelope with (I think an I on it). This lets me know I sent an reminder out.


I tried to copy the sheet to another one and it now says set reminder. I there a way to have that back to send a reminder email?

    The Update Request column will appear as soon as you have sent at least one request from this new sheet.

    For the very first request you will need to send it using the method you described above (using the drop-down arrow from the row menu or right-clicking on the row number). As soon as you've sent out an update request, even if it's just a tester one to your own email address, this column will be automatically input into your sheet and you can send out new update requests by using this field instead.     There is a "Send..." option which simply sends the row information, or there is a "Send Update Request" option. You'll want to select the "Send Update Request" from this menu:


    The column won't change if you only send row information, as this isn't an Update Request. Once you have a pending update request for the row, you should see this as a quick-action for other rows, too.
